Do I need to install Yosemite in order to build a Swift iOS app?

I would like to try building a swift app, but I am afraid to upgrade my Mac to Yosemite Developer Preview. I am not clear if this is a prerequisite.

Just to get the official source in here, the Xcode 6 Beta 1 Release Notes state:

Xcode 6 Beta requires a Mac running OS X version 10.9.3 (or later) or 10.10.

And Xcode 6 comes bundled with Swift.

It's not a prerequisite. You can install the XCode 6 beta which includes swift support as long as you have the newest version of Mavericks (10.9.3)
